Den här rapporten undersöker olikheterna mellan två liknande modell kontrollerare med olika implementationer av den partiella order reduktionen, Java Pathfinder och Moonwalker, genom att fokusera på deras tillståndsreduktion och tiden det tar att göra reduktionen.
This report examines the differences between two similar model checkers with different implementations of the partial order reductions, Java Pathfinder and Moonwalker, by focusing on its state reduction feature and the time it takes to do the reduction.
Genom att göra en teoretisk jämförelse kommer den här rapporten att försöka svara på vilken partiell order reduktion är bäst och testa Java Pathfinder för ett antagande om hur Moonwalker skulle bete sig i relevant kod.
By doing a theoretical comparison this paper tries to answer the questions stated and the testing of Java Pathfinder will deduce how Moonwalker would behave compared to Java Pathfinder for a relevant code.
Resultatet var att Moonwalker reducerar likvärdigt antal tillstånd som Java Pathfinder, men att Java Pathfinder överträffar Moonwalker en aning.
The result was that both Moonwalker and Java Pathfinder reduces most of the states, where Java Pathfinder outperforms Moonwalker slightly.
Conținut posibil inadecvat
Exemplele au rolul de a te ajuta să traduci cuvinte sau expresii corect si adaptat la context. Nu sunt selectate sau validate manual, așadar pot conține termeni inadecvați. Te rugăm să raportezi exemplele pe care le consideri inadecvate. Traducerile vulgare sau colocviale sunt în general marcate cu roșu sau cu portocaliu.